WHAT IS INTELLIGENT ELEVATE NETWORKS?

With the advent of cloud computing, many businesses have turned to hosted services for managing IT resources that include network topology, servers, data storage, and even complete data centers.  This evolution in technology now extends to communications infrastructure, allowing providers to offer access to sophisticated functionality without the acquisition, maintenance, and management expense that goes along with building such systems in-house.

WHY SHOULD YOUR SMB ADOPT INTELLIGENT ELEVATE NETWORKS?

Integrated unified communications offer many advantages for both large enterprises and small business owners:

  • Reduce the demand on existing IT staff. Intelligent Elevate Networks providers manage equipment configuration, installation, and upgrades.
  • Cloud-based architecture ensures access from any location, leveraging the power of the internet.
  • Scalability – pay only for what you need, with ease of expansion as your business grows or needs change.
  • Financial advantage – Intelligent Elevate Networks can often be funded as an operating expense, without the up-front cost of purchasing equipment or periodic upgrade costs.
  • Security – cybersecurity is a critical concern for most businesses. Intelligent Elevate Networks providers provide a secure environment with continuous updates for subscriber protection. Many are also compliant with regulations such as SOX, PCI, and HIPAA.
  • Reliability – redundancy is built into Intelligent Elevate Networks offerings, providing consistent access to business systems, phone connectivity, video conferencing, and internet services.
  • Reduced time to implement – providers handle planning, installation, and support, accelerating deployment time.
